首頁  >  文章  >  後端開發  >  PHP實現即時動物體感知系統技術綜述

PHP實現即時動物體感知系統技術綜述

WBOY
WBOY原創
2023-06-28 10:04:021349瀏覽

隨著物聯網技術的快速發展和電腦視覺演算法的不斷進步,即時動物體感知系統越來越受到人們的關注和研究。這種系統可以透過電腦視覺演算法處理攝影機捕捉到的影像和視頻,精確地識別出影像中的動物對象,並對其進行分類和跟踪,實現對動​​物行為的監測、警報和計數等功能。在實際應用中,即時動物體感知系統被廣泛應用於野生動物保護、農業生產、交通監控等領域。

PHP作為一種流行的動態網頁開發語言,在即時動物體感知系統的開發中具有重要的作用。本文將對PHP實現即時動物體感知系統技術進行綜述。

  1. PHP在電腦視覺中的應用

電腦視覺是實現即時動物體感知系統的基礎,PHP作為一種伺服器端腳本語言,在電腦視覺應用中可以透過呼叫OpenCV等開源函式庫來實現影像處理和機器學習。透過PHP腳本獲取動態產生的影像或視訊串流,並透過呼叫OpenCV庫進行影像處理與分析,實現即時的動物體感知系統。 PHP也可以透過呼叫TensorFlow等框架,進行深度學習模型的訓練與應用,提升動物體感知系統的準確率。

  1. PHP與即時動物體感知系統的結合

PHP可以透過Apache等伺服器軟體來建立web伺服器,實現對即時動物體感知系統的監控與管理。透過在web介面中嵌入PHP腳本,可以實現對即時動物體感知系統的動態顯示、警報和管理等功能。同時,PHP還可以實現對系統產生的數據進行儲存和分析,例如對動物行為進行分析和建模等,為即時動物體感知系統提供更多的應用情境。

  1. PHP實作即時動物體感知系統的實作步驟

(1)建立web伺服器:使用Apache等伺服器軟體建立web伺服器,並在伺服器中設定PHP環境,以支援PHP腳本。

(2)取得視訊串流數據:透過PHP腳本取得攝影機捕捉到的即時視訊串流數據,並進行即時處理和分析。

(3)影像處理和分類:透過呼叫OpenCV等函式庫來實現對視訊串流資料的影像處理和分類,例如使用Haar Cascades演算法進行動物目標偵測。

(4)資料儲存與分析:透過MySQL等資料庫技術實現對系統產生的資料進行儲存和分析,並透過PHP腳本實現資料視覺化和分析。

(5)互動介面實作:透過PHP腳本實現動態的web介面,包括動物監測資料的顯示、警報通知和管理等功能。

  1. PHP實現即時動物體感知系統的優缺點

(1)優點:PHP的開發簡單、快速,易於部署和修改。同時,PHP是一種流行的web開發語言,可以透過web介面實現對即時動物體感知系統的管理和監控,為使用者提供友善的互動介面和數據展示。

(2)缺點:由於PHP是一種解釋性腳本語言,在效能方面相對較差,需要在處理大量影像資料時極為謹慎。同時,PHP的安全性相對較低,需要開發者採取一系列安全措施以避免系統受到攻擊。

總之,PHP作為一種流行的web開發語言,在即時動物體感知系統的開發中具有一定的優勢和挑戰,需要結合自身的特點進行合理的選擇和應用。透過整合電腦視覺和web技術,並結合大數據分析和機器學習等技術,PHP實現的即時動物體感知系統有望在動物保護、農業生產和交通監測等領域發揮更重要和廣泛的作用。

以上是PHP實現即時動物體感知系統技術綜述的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n